TP官方网址下载|TokenPocket官方网站|IOS版/安卓版下载-tp官方下载安卓最新版本2024
一、概述与场景
TP(TokenPocket)钱包支持在手机或桌面中通过内置 DApp 浏览器或 WalletConnect 与去中心化交易所(DEX)交互,实现 ERC20 与原生 ETH 之间的兑换。常见场景包括:用 ERC20 换 ETH、用 ETH 买 ERC20、跨链桥兑换为以太坊上的 ETH(或 WETH)。
二、在 TP 钱包中兑换 ETH 的常规步骤(用户向导)
1) 打开 TP,选择网络(以太坊主网或 Layer2)。
2) 进入 DApp(如 Uniswap、Sushi、Pancake 的跨链版本或聚合器)。
3) 选择交易对、填写数量并设置滑点与截止时间。滑点通常设 0.5%~1%(视流动性而定)。
4) 若为 ERC20 首次交互,需先调用 approve 授权合约;之后发起 swap 交易确认并支付 gas。
5) 等待链上确认,检查交易哈希与接收地址。

安全提示:确认合约地址、使用硬件签名或 TP 的冷钱包方案,避免授权无限期 approve,注意高额滑点与可疑 DApp。
三、关键合约函数(常见于 DEX / 聚合器)
- ERC20: approve(address spender, uint256 amount), transfer(address to, uint256 amount), transferFrom(address from, address to, uint256 amount)
- UniswapV2 型: swapExactTokensForTokens(uint amountIn, uint amountOutMin, address[] path, address to, uint deadline)
- UniswapV2 ETH 相关: swapExactETHForTokens(uint amountOutMin, address[] path, address to, uint deadline) payable
- UniswapV3 型: exactInputSingle / exactInput(支持 fee 和路径格式)
- 聚合器/多调用: multicall(bytes[] data) — 将多次调用合并为一次交易以节省 gas
- permit(EIP-2612): permit(address owner, address spender, uint256 value, uint256 deadline, uint8 v, bytes32 r, bytes32 s) — 允许免 on-chain approve 的签名授权
理解:用户使用 TP 发起签名;合约函数由 DApp 发起交易,钱包负责签名与广播。
四、新兴科技趋势与对兑换的影响
- zk-rollups 与 optimistic rollups:降低 gas 成本,提高吞吐,有利于低成本兑换。对用户体验有直接提升。
- Account Abstraction(EIP-4337):使智能合约钱包更强大,支持更灵活的签名策略与社会恢复,改善 UX 与安全性。
- 跨链流动性与通道:跨链桥与流动性聚合器让兑换路径更多样,但同时引入桥层风险。
- MEV 与前置交易缓解:闪兑、路由器与聚合器越来越多地采用 MEV 抗性策略,改善滑点与执行价格。
五、区块存储与高效存储方案
- 区块链存储特性:链上保存交易与状态(账户、合约 storage),使用 Merkle/Patricia Trie 保证可验证性。
- 高效方案:将大量数据放到链外(IPFS、Arweave、去中心化对象存储),链上仅存哈希/指针;使用 calldata 压缩、事件日志(比 storage 更省 gas)、状态租赁或分层存储。
- 对 DEX/聚合器:使用链下订单簿、光速路由计算与链上最终结算的混合方案,降低链上负担。
六、私密资产操作与隐私技术
- 隐私工具:zk-SNARK/zk-STARK(匿名转账与证明)、CoinJoin 型协议、混币服务(须注意合规风险)。
- 隐私智能合约:shielded pool(如 Tornado Cash 的技术方向),可以与合规链上分析做权衡。

- 实操建议:高敏感度资产使用冷钱包、离线签名与最小授权;在合规允许下使用隐私增强技术。
七、高可用性设计(对钱包与服务端)
- 多节点冗余:RPC 提供者采用多家冗余(Infura/Alchemy/自建节点),自动切换失败节点。
- 负载均衡与缓存:对频繁查询采用本地缓存,减少对主链压力。
- 交易重试与回退策略:在签名失败或 gas 波动时提供重试、手续费调整与用户提示。
- 离线恢复与备份:助记词/私钥多重备份、智能合约钱包的社会恢复与多签方案提升可用性与安全。
八、专家视角与风险评估
- 风险要点:合约漏洞、假 DApp 钓鱼、桥的托管风险、流动性风险与价格滑点。专家建议采用分批兑换、使用信誉良好聚合器、限制授权金额、使用硬件签名并定期审计进行第三方检测。
九、实践清单(快速确认项)
1) 确认网络与接收地址。 2) 确认 DApp 合约地址与审计信息。 3) 设置合理滑点与截止时间。 4) 优先使用 permit 或最小 approve,避免无限授权。 5) 使用可信 RPC 并开启交易通知与确认。 6) 需要隐私时评估合规风险并采用合适方案。
结语:在 TP 钱包中兑换以太坊不仅是对单次交易流程的掌握,更关乎对合约函数、存储架构、隐私保护与高可用性设计的理解。结合新兴技术(如 zk-rollup、Account Abstraction)与稳健的安全实践,可以在提升效率与体验的同时,控制风险。